What a setting really does
Two jobs determine an engagement setting. First, it safeguards the center rock. Second, it frames exactly how you experience that stone each day. Setting height finds out whether a ring records coats or slides easily in to gloves. Metal colour can easily push a diamond's body system colour warmer or even cooler. The ring's overall architecture affects exactly how wedding bands rest flush, just how frequently you'll be actually back for prong firm, as well as exactly how the carat body weight appears relative to finger size.
The Houston market leans toward tough creates. Moisture by itself is actually no villain, yet the area's energetic way of living means rings satisfy sunblock, guiding wheels, cycling grasps, and also yard barbecue devices. A fragile micro pavé can easily survive it all, but just if the maker balanced skill along with architectural stability. A really good jeweler will certainly speak you via that trade.

Prong setups: the Houston favored with range
When most people picture diamond engagement rings, they imagine points storing a facility stone. Four as well as six prongs prevail. Four series even more of the diamond's edge as well as optimizes light come back from the edges. Six adds verboseness if one prong falls short, and also it can easily pivot the outline of a square or even egg-shaped so it really feels softer on the hand. A well-cut 1.50 carat shot in a slim six-prong head on a conical shank appears classic and also reviews larger considering that the prongs creatively blur right into a rounded outline.
Height matters. Houston buyers usually request a mid-profile scalp, concerning 6 to 7 millimeters from hands to table on a 1 to 2 carat sphere. That maintains the stone intense but lessens getting. The secret is to keep prong ideas portable as well as symmetrical, whether you decide on rounded "claws" or even stimulating talon ideas. Platinum points hold better over many years, especially on higher carat diamonds that take additional influence. If you like yellowish or even increased gold engagement rings, take into consideration a platinum point head on a gold shank. The different colors difference is refined from regular looking at span, however the durability gain is actually real.
Prongs are not "specified and also forget." Anticipate a check-up every 12 to 18 months for firming up as well as a quick gloss. Under a microscope, prong wear and tear appears as smoothed ideas or even thinned shoulders, particularly on rings used daily on area commutes and at weekend break games.
Bezel setups: security with present day understatement
A frame surrounds the stone's edge with steel, nestling it like a framework. In Houston, doctor and also designers favor frames because they steer clear of grabs and guard the diamond or sapphire from cracking at the band. The appearance can be smooth and present-day. A 1.00 carat oval in a lean platinum eagle bezel on a 2 millimeter band goes through tailored, tidy, as well as unfussy. Total frames develop one of the most safety and security. Fifty percent frames leave behind openings at the aspects, welcoming lighting while protecting a hassle-free profile.
Do frames fade a diamond? Not always. Most of a rounded dazzling's shimmer comes from light entering into and also jumping with the crown as well as pavilion, not the sides. The bezel does conceal the side view, thus if you adore the "fish-eye" of lighting at the girdle, you'll miss out on that. On the other hand, bezels can hone a diamond's profile, help make a lightly lengthened oval look more well balanced, or mask a slightly out-of-round antique cut.
For shade, frames simulate a reflector. White gold or even platinum always keeps a diamond appearing cool. Yellowish gold may discreetly warm a near-colorless diamond and also produce lesser color levels believe intended. This comes in handy when you wish to prioritize carat or even reduce without paying for a premium for icy color.
Pave as well as micro pavé: lightweight throughout the finger
Pavé utilizes little diamonds established carefully in the band or even halo, secured by tiny grains or single-cut points. Micro pavé, commonly with 1 millimeter to 1.5 millimeter stones, considers that high glimmer you see in restaurant candlelight. Houston clients demand pavé on three parts of a ring: a halo around the facility, the shoulders of the band, and occasionally the gallery.
The gains are actually obvious. Pavé spreadings shimmer so the ring glints also when the center rock experiences downward momentarily. It likewise lets you range budget by deciding on a slightly smaller sized center diamond as well as encompassing it with alright fray from a well-matched collection. The trade is servicing. Tiny diamonds carry out happen loose over years of damage. Quality matters at the seat. Shared-prong pavé with precise chair cutting delays much better than bead-and-bright-cut done too shallow. Generally, if you can easily feel roughness along the edges, it will see lint as well as hair. Well-executed pavé feels smooth to the finger.
For daily damage in Houston warmth, sun screen lotion as well as ointment movie will certainly silence micro pavé within times. Ultrasound cleansing at a shop wakes it back up. If you want the appearance without the hassle, limit the pavé to the best fifty percent of the shank and also always keep the underside strong for comfort.

Halos that boost instead of overwhelm
Halos add a dazzling structure. The greatest halos caress the outline of the facility stone with preciseness, usually within tenths of a millimeter. When the gap is actually too vast, the ring reads through as two separate parts as well as the visual improvement lessens. In Houston, where several clients seek a certain underrated style, I see even more thin halos along with 1.0 to 1.3 millimeter diamonds than beefy ones.
Shapes concern. A halo can correct or even highlight. For a somewhat lengthened pillow, a softly pillowed halo always keeps the charming shape. For an oblong along with a high length-to-width ratio, a halo may produce it show up bigger and also balance the finger. Halos additionally defend, working as a stream around the center, which is useful for breakable antique diamonds or even colored gemstone facilities like emerald or even morganite.
Three-stone rings: importance and spread
Three stones supply past-present-future meaning and also a great deal of finger insurance coverage. Arounds with conical baguettes remain a Houston staple. Ovals flanked by half-moon diamonds really feel existing without going stylish. The key is actually portion. Edge stones generally function best around 20 to 40 percent of the center's carat body weight each, relying on form. Very large, and also they contend. As well tiny, and also they disappear.
Pay interest to profile page. A three-stone develop often tends to manage wider, so plan ahead about wedding rings. Straight bands hardly rest flawlessly flush unless the facility head is actually engineered for it. Several customers select a delicate bent band or a customized wedding band with a little mark that syncs the engagement ring.

Metal options and also exactly how they grow old here
White gold, yellow gold, increased gold, and platinum eagle all belong. Virtual:
- Platinum gives the very best prong durability as well as always keeps a white look without replating. It builds a smooth grey patina that can be polished bright. This matches those that put on rings hard and desire very little upkeep.
Yellow gold continues to lead demands in Houston, particularly for jewelry and also vintage-influenced concepts. It flatters a large range of complexion as well as creates the diamonds come if you always keep points in white metal.
White gold is preferred for a sharp, bright frame around diamonds. It carries out need rhodium replating every 12 to 24 months depending upon damage. If you utilize white gold points, think about that company cadence.
Rose gold is actually greatest set up either as a total ring for warmer rocks, including sparkling wine diamonds and also morganite, or even as an accent in two-tone styles. On near-colorless diamonds, rose gold can easily cast a cozy representation if made use of for prongs, thus evaluate an example before finalizing.
Matching wedding bands without drama
A typical regret comes 6 months after the proposal: the engagement ring looks wonderful solo, however every direct wedding band leaves behind a void. That is actually not a failing. It's just natural sciences. Heads that flare, halos that extend, and unnoticeable bezels often shut out a direct band. Solutions feature a small scallop band, a V or chevron, or a custom-mapped shape. If you understand you wish a flawlessly flush pile along with straight bands, tell your jewelry expert up-front. They are going to narrow the foundation of the scalp, increase it somewhat, or readjust the shoulder geometry so the wedding rings slide underneath.
For pavé bands, match melee dimension and also setting style if you desire a consolidated collection. A half-eternity in 1.3 millimeter diamonds with micro pavé alongside a 1.5 millimeter French-set engagement shank appears inconsistent up close. Minor improvements at the bench remedy that. If you choose comparison, move deliberate: a plain 2.0 millimeter gold band against a pavé engagement ring develops a well-maintained split that checks out intentional.
Colored gems in Houston light
Diamonds dominate engagement rings, however gems possess a constant audience below. Sapphires, both blue and also teal, handle everyday wear effectively. Rubies sit close behind. Emerald carries that rich Houston-garden power, however the stone is actually softer and also commonly featured, thus bezel or even halo environments aid shield it. Morganite and also aquamarine look beautiful in rose or even yellowish gold however need cautious wear and tear as well as routine cleaning due to the fact that cream dulls them faster.
If you opt for a gemstone facility, condition the setting to the rock's requirements. A more defensive head, slightly more thick points, and a halo barrier decrease solution visits. For teal sapphire in oval or even padding shapes, a slim yellow gold frame can create the colour radiance while soothing zoning lines that show in intense sunlight.
Cut premium and also carat illusions
You observe carat weight theoretically. You view size in situation. A 1.25 carat around with an exceptional hairstyle frequently encounters up similarly to a 1.40 carat along with a deep-seated pavilion, and it appears livelier. Great setters in Houston participate in that to your conveniences. Great prongs, tapered shoulders, and also very carefully chosen head sizes make the facility experience bigger. Even the shank's indoor comfort-fit contour adjustments just how the ring sits and also just how much stone you view as you tilt your hand.
If your spending plan is taken care of, focus on reduce first. At that point take into consideration different colors as well as quality selections that behave properly in your selected metal. In yellowish gold, many G by means of J diamonds look dazzling. In platinum eagle, a lot of clients land in between F and H for a traditional white appeal. Quality may fall to SI ranges if the inclusions rest adrift and stay away from the prong windows. Ask to look at the diamond in direct sunshine, tone, and also store lighting fixtures. Houston's intense, open heavens take out different facets than inside LEDs.

Practical upkeep in a hot, sweltering city
Rings live realities right here. Heat increases fingers, at that point a/c diminishes them. Consider a spring insert or a tiny sizing bar if your size rises and fall majority a dimension daily. Take the ring off for weightlifting, chlorine swimming pools, and also heavy garden job. Clean in the home every week along with warm and comfortable water, a drop of meal soap, and a soft comb. Ultrasonic cleaning services work thinks about on diamonds, yet inquire to begin with if your ring has pavé, antique rocks, or even alleviated gemstones that can be vulnerable.
Expect a company rhythm. Tightening and gloss each year or so, replating if you picked white gold, a complete examination after hard knocks. A good Houston jeweler always keeps documents of your ring's specs, from fray carat as well as different colors to specific point steel, therefore repair work match the initial build.
